Noun [edit]

Christmas Day (plural Christmas Days)

  1. the day on which Christmas is celebrated. Usually held on December 25 in the West, and January 7 in some Eastern Orthodox churches.
    • 1737, Thomas Collins, The rubrick of the Church of England, examin'd and consider'd
      When Christmas Day falls upon a Saturday {as it did in 1736,) the Collect, Epistle and Gospel for St. Stephen's Day follows of Course, and no Notice is taken of the Sunday after Christmas Day
